Substations located in the middle of a load area are called distribution substations. These substations may be as close together as 2 miles in densely populated areas. The substations contain power transformers that reduce the voltage from sub-transmission levels to distribution levels, usually in the range of 4.16Y/2.4 kV to 34.5Y/19.92 kV.

The Definition and Purpose of Electrical Substations What is an Electrical Substation? An electrical substation is a key facility within the power grid that transforms voltage from high to low or vice versa, manages the flow of electricity between different circuits, and provides a means for controlling and protecting the network. Green Bay in Wisconsin, US, has approved plans to develop the city''s first standalone utility-scale battery energy storage system (BESS). In a meeting Monday, the City of Green Bay Plan Commission authorised a Conditional Use Permit (CUP) to allow Tern Energy Storage LLC to establish a BESS on 8.1 acres of land.

A substation is a part of an electrical generation, transmission, and distribution system. Substations transform voltage from high to low, or the reverse, or perform any of several other important functions. Between the generating station and the consumer, electric power may flow through several substations at different voltage levels.

Energy time-shift works by charging an energy storage system when electricity is cheap—typically during off-peak hours when demand is low and renewable energy sources like wind and solar are producing more energy than can be immediately consumed. Instead of curtailing this excess energy, it is stored in ESS.

An energy storage box substation is a substation that integrates a traditional substation and energy storage system in a box. It is mainly composed of transformers, circuit breakers, cable connectors, isolation switches, current transformers, voltage transformers, capacitors, reactors, energy storage devices, and other auxiliary equipment.

The development will comprise the construction and operation of a battery storage scheme, with a total capacity of 400 MW. The principal components of the development include: 216 Battery Energy Storage units, each one approximately 16.6m x 3.7m x 3.5m in size, housing the battery blocks, inverters, heating, ventilation and transformers

Korea Electric Power Corp. (KEPCO) has completed construction of a large battery energy storage project in Miryang, Gyeongsangnam-do Province. As Asia''s largest battery energy storage system for grid stabilization, it has a power output of 978 MW and a storage capacity of 889 MWh.
